Since everyone covered the immensely powerful ones, I will throw one in that is more interesting and fun:

Turian Sentinel w/ Suppressor

This will one-shot every Gold Cerberus humanoid (after Overload for shielded units), and should kill a Dragoon in 3.

You can use a Rail Amp instead of Targeting VI, but it increases STK on Centurion and Nemesis to 3 if you don't Overload.

Gear and Armor is your choice, and you could potentially drop the last rank of Warp for Fitness 4 if you really want since you aren't Incendiary glitching.
